About

Description

We were having trouble finding a modpack with Vampirism that had all the other features we wanted, but was still lightweight enough to run on our budget gamer PCs.
So I bit the bullet and put this together. After a few days of bug fixing and fine tuning I've come out with a light weight modpack (~150 mods) that runs relatively smoothly. Smooth for modded minecraft that is.

Basic features:

  • Vampirism/werewolves
  • Spoopy magic mods
  • Monsters to fight with your new powers
  • Enough tech mods for automation and factories
  • Rewards for farming/cooking. (max hp bonuses for eating different foods, up to 410 items)
  • Twilight Forest, The Bumblezone, and The Undergarden for exploration
  • A small library worth of game optimisiation mods
  • A nice shader and some custom models for cows/pigs/chickens/bunnies
  • As much QoL as I could think to cram into the pack!

Use the Essential mod to play with friends, use FTB teams to make a party, and get out there!

Modlist Overview:

Magic:
Blood Magic, Botania, Eidolon: Repraised, Mana and Artifice, Occultism, Vampirism & Werewolves (+addons)

Tech:
Ad Astra, Create (+some addons), Immersive Aircraft, Iron Chests, Iron Furnaces, Mekanism(+addons), Thermal (+addons)

Exploration:
Alex's Mobs, Doggy Talents Next (level up tamed wolves!), Explorify, Gliders, Goblin Traders, Ice and Fire: Dragons, Incendium, Kobolds!, Terralith, The Bumblezone, The Twilight Forest, The Undergarden, Towns and Towers, Waystones

Quality of Life:
Comforts (sleep through the day), Corpse (leave a body after death to recover items from), Easy Piglins, Easy Villagers, Explorer's Compass (locate structures), FTB Ultimine (vein mining+), Jade (or "wailia"), Just Enough Items (+addons), Lootr (each player gets loot from overworld chests), Magnum Torch, Mob Lassos, Nature's Compass (locate biomes), Xaero's Minimap and World Map
